Learning to Make Jewelry

Good quality pays off in the long run

When I first started making jewelry, I had received zero instruction. I hadn't even read about how to do a proper square knot or how to finish off fishing line. My jewelry was pretty, but I did not have quality finishings and sometimes not even quality material.

With time I started learning (some by trial and error, some by instruction) and my jewelry kept looking better and better. But, there were times when I would bump into someone that bought my jewelry when I had first started and see them wearing a pair of earrings I had made with some awfully shaped simple loops, or with craft wire that had tarnished... it was simply embarrassing! And it was all because I hadn't taken the time to learn about the basics, about materials and also I didn't want to spend money on it.

Now I understand that when you pay for knowledge you will be later using, it's really an investment. So, don't be afraid to 'invest' some money on a tutorial, or to buy a how-to magazine or book, it will pay off in the future. Your customers will appreciate your craftsmanship, your jewelry will last longer looking good and it will all come back to you in more sales.

My favorite magazine is Step by Step Wire Jewelry, which offers projects for different levels. Also for some free tutorials on wire basics, check out the Bead and Button Magazine site .
